​​Over 15,000 People in Nevada County are Hungry
​
Who are these people? They are families, senior citizens, veterans, the working poor and the disabled. Without Interfaith Food Ministry and other supportive agencies, they would not know where their next meal is coming from.
September is Hunger Action Month, where we focus on our neighbors in need. But what can you do?
PLENTY! And it's so easy to help.
1. Start your own fundraiser - If you're having a dinner party or game night, add a fundraising element. Ask guests to bring a canned food item or make a contribution.
2. Start a fundraiser for IFM on Facebook to support Hunger Action Month.
3. Become a volunteer at IFM. You can commit to a day a month or whatever works for your schedule. Recruit a buddy and increase the fun! Here is the list of volunteer positions at IFM.
We are now doing Saturday distributions and are looking for volunteers
from  8 am -1 pm.


4. Get the whole family involved! Partner with your children's sports program to hold a food drive at one of the games. IFM has food barrels you can use for the food drive.

5. Go orange for the month of September. Put on your favorite orange shirt or pants and help us spread the word that hunger is real in Nevada County! Take a picture and send to IFM and we'll post it on Facebook.
